Recap: material design's new motion system and the freezed package...
Here's the latest and greatest from the Flutter-verse. Enjoy!Don't forget you can always get these recaps delivered straight to your inbox.____Slick animations made easy 🙌Our friends on the Flutter team have released a new animations package based on the new Material Motion system. The Motion system is a set of four transition patterns that are "designed to help users navigate and understand an app by reinforcing relationships between UI elements." Basically, it helps you make your app look slick... Tell me more about this Motion system...check out this write-up by Jonas Naimark, a Motion designer from Google, that provides an intro into the system and patterns. Official spec here if you missed it above.Animations in Flutter...interested in understanding how Motion works under the hood? Here's a nice intro to ease you into how animations work in Flutter.____Baby, it's cold outside...🥶Missing those data and sealed classes from Kotlin? Remi Rousselet, Flutter God, has released a new package called freezed that handles data classes, unions, and much more in a single package. It's also light on the boilerplate 👌How the hell do I use it?…if the official docs weren't enough for you, check out this tutorial from Resocoder.But I already use built_value... curious why you might need freezed if you're already using built_value? Here's a great article from Martin Kamleithner that dives into how freezed stacks up against built_value.____Elsewhere in the Flutterverse...🪐LINQ for Dart...say what you want about .NET, LINQ is a really useful way to query data across data sources. The darq package brings a subset of LINQ functionality to Dart Iterables, which makes querying data on data sources like List and Set easy-peasy.And the Flutter Clock Contest winner is...the particle clock by Mickel! Read more about his journey developing the clock and achieving Flutter stardom.Convincing your boss Flutter is the 💣...ready to start adopting Flutter at your company but getting some resistance from your boss or teammates? New post on /r/flutterdev subreddit:

[provider] view model with collection of objects
Hello,I'm pretty new to flutter (and mobile development in general) and I'm trying to plan my app's architecture with provider.​I have a state model that has collection of objects that have a collection of objects inside as well (think collection of todo lists):
class StateModel extends ChangeNotifier { List<TodoList> todoLists; } 
simplified TodoList class looks like this:
class TodoList { int id; List<Item> items; } class Item { int id; String name; bool status; // true is done, false is not done } 
Now one of my Views is ListView of my todo lists (where I display only name) and that's east. But I want to have a todo list detail view (where data of single todo list is displayed) where I want to mark todo items as done (i.e. set their status to true). How should I do it? I could have method in StateModel which would find a TodoList object by id, then mark items as done. This could look something like this:
class StateModel extends ChangeNotifier { // (...) void markItemAsDone(listId, itemId) { // find todo list in StateModel // find item in given list // mark it as done // notifyListeners() } } 
But this seems wrong. What I would like to have is a way to get TodoList object view model and use its methods, not StateModel methods. How should I approach this? Can I have another view model (TodoListState), and have a collection of TodoListState objects in StateModel? Is this a use case for ProxyProvider?​I hope my question is clear, let me know if this needs more explanation.
